我正在尝试将 XML 数据从网页转换为 PDF 文件,并且希望能够完全在 JavaScript 中完成此操作。我需要能够绘制文本、图像和简单的形状。我希望能够完全在浏览器中完成此操作。
我刚刚写了一个名为jsPDF https://github.com/MrRio/jsPDF它仅使用 Javascript 生成 PDF。它还很年轻,我很快就会添加功能和错误修复。还获得了一些在不支持数据 URI 的浏览器中解决方法的想法。它是根据麻省理工学院的自由许可证获得许可的。
我在开始写这个问题之前就遇到了这个问题,我想我会回来让你知道:)
在 Javascript 中生成 PDF https://github.com/MrRio/jsPDF
示例创建一个“Hello World”PDF 文件。
// Default export is a4 paper, portrait, using milimeters for units
var doc = new jsPDF()
doc.text('Hello world!', 10, 10)
doc.save('a4.pdf')
<script src="https://cdnjs.cloudflare.com/ajax/libs/jspdf/1.3.5/jspdf.debug.js"></script>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)